Cassie + Friends and Brain Canada Announce a New Research Partnership to Transform the Mental Health of Youth with Pediatric Rheumatic Disease


VANCOUVER, British Columbia, May 07,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Cassie + Friends (C + F) and Brain Canada are pleased to announce their new partnership to fund research that will address mental health in youth with rheumatic diseases such as juvenile arthritis and lupus - conditions that affect every 3 in 1000 kids or 24,000 children across Canada. Together, they want to provide support to children and families living with these painful, chronic, and potentially devastating conditions, and ensure they receive timely care and treatment for their mental health needs.

Pediatric rheumatic diseases can have long-term physical and psychosocial effects on a young person. These conditions can result in chronic pain, fatigue, and physical limitations that can impact the day-to-day and overall quality of life of children and teenagers as well as young adults. Youth with these conditions, and especially females, are at increased risk of developing mental illnesses characterized by alterations in thinking, mood or behaviour associated with significant distress and impaired functioning, such as anxiety and depression.

Despite the prevalence of co-occurring mental illnesses in pediatric rheumatic diseases, estimated at up to 40 per cent, there is a lack of understanding regarding the factors that contribute to their development, mental health screening for early identification and assessment, as well as limited treatment options to provide timely and appropriate care and support.

With a total funding envelope of $480,000, C+F and Brain Canada are pleased to support two team grants of $240,000 each over two years with an aim to support research that will improve our understanding of the prevention, diagnosis, and treatment of mental illnesses in children and youth.
